England rugby legend Ben Youngs has recounted the tumultuous 2011 Rugby World Cup campaign, marked by scandalous events including a "dwarf-chucking" incident in Queenstown, allegations of player misconduct towards a hotel cleaner, and Manu Tuilagi’s arrest in Auckland. In his book, Beyond the Line – My Life in Rugby, Youngs reflects on the lasting impact of these off-field distractions and the team’s disappointing quarter-final exit.
